@askvinh: QUICK TIP: Look for friendly faces when you're presenting or giving a speech Avoid looking at those who are bored, yawning, or phased out - because then your focus shifts to trying to impress them. Focus on the people who look engaged instead - these are the people who are getting the most value from you!
